Description
This 1996 Subaru Sambar is a well equipped truck that’s capable and compact enough to fit anywhere. Subaru is well-known for making capable all wheel drive vehicles, and their smallest offering is not to disappoint. This Sambar is equipped with part-time 4WD, activated by a big red button on the shifter, and also features an extra-low crawler gear for especially sticky situations. All four wheels are driven by Subaru’s Clover 4-cylinder 660cc engine, providing adequate power and torque for a small truck like this. It also comes with air conditioning to keep you cool on hot days on the trail. All in all, the Sambar will get you and your cargo wherever you need to go in comfort, no matter what the conditions are.
Condition
This Sambar is in fine condition for a commercial truck of its age. The engine is running and idling smoothly, the transmission engages in all gears smoothly with minimal slippage, and the 4WD system engages and disengages just as it should. All electronics are working fine, with no irregularities to report. The body seems to have been repainted and also features decals with some faded remnants of the previous owner's graphics. There was some damage to the passenger side door and body below the door, as well as chipped and peeling paint on the front bumper. The interior is average, with a few rips, scrapes, and scratches inside. Underneath the truck is clean, with minimal rust and no corrosion spots or major rust areas.
